Introduction
The function and performance of Arda DV-1 digital viscometer have reached or exceeded the professional level of the same type abroad.It adopts16A digital viscosity measuring instrument with a stepper motor high subdivision drive and a digital LCD with blue backlight function as the core of the microcomputer processor.The DV-1 Digital Viscometer is a program-controlled Rotational Viscometer that can be connected to a computer and printer.
Features
1. The speed is stable and accurate, the key is clearly marked, the program is designed, and the operation is simple.
2. When the torque is lowerIf 10% is higher than 90% of the measurement range, the instrument will sound an alarm.
3. The RTD temperature probe can monitor and measure the viscosity temperature in real time with an accuracy of 0.1°C. The temperature measurement range is 0°C-120°C.
4. The screen directly displays the viscosity, speed, temperature, percentmeter torque, rotor number and the maximum viscosity value that can be measured by the selected rotor at the current speed.
5. Optional RS232 interface printing, printing interval set by user.
6. The main control board and subdivision driver board all adopt SMD technology, and the circuit design adopts the current professional microcomputer processor, and the structural layout is reasonable and compact.
7. Digital viscometerThe full-scale range and linearity of each gear are all measured and corrected through the PC interface, and their measurement performance and function have reached the same type of professional level abroad.
Product Applications
The DV-1 digital viscometer is used to measure the viscous resistance of liquids and the dynamic viscosity of liquids. Includes Newtonian liquid and non-Newtonian liquid measurements. It can be widely used to determine the viscosity of various fluids such as grease, paint, food, coating, papermaking, cosmetics, chemical industry, capsule adhesive and so on.
